The report highlights the importance of API security in the modern digital landscape.
API Security: A Growing Concern in the Digital Age
The Rise of API-Related Flaws
A recent report from Wallarm has revealed a concerning trend in the digital world: a 21% increase in API-related flaws.
The Rise of Client-Side Flaws: A Growing Concern
The recent data from Wallarm highlights a concerning trend in the world of cybersecurity: an increase in client-side flaws, such as OAuth misconfiguration and cross-site issues. These types of vulnerabilities are becoming more prevalent, and it’s essential to understand the root causes of this issue.
The Role of API Integration
API integration has become a crucial aspect of modern software development. With the rise of cloud computing and microservices architecture, APIs have become the primary means of communication between different systems.
Misconfigured APIs can have devastating consequences for organizations and their stakeholders.
These issues can lead to unauthorized access, data breaches, and other security threats.
Understanding the Risks of API Security Issues
API security issues can have far-reaching consequences, affecting not only the organization but also its customers and partners.
Protecting APIs from Security Risks Requires Strong Governance and Best Practices.
Poor posture governance refers to the lack of proper security controls and measures in place to protect an organization’s API keys, credentials, and other sensitive data.
Understanding API Security Risks
APIs are a critical component of modern software development, providing a way for different systems to communicate and exchange data. However, this increased connectivity also brings significant security risks. APIs can be vulnerable to various types of attacks, including:
The Impact of Poor Posture Governance
Poor posture governance can have severe consequences for organizations. Some of the key impacts include:
Best Practices for API Security
To mitigate the risks associated with APIs, organizations can implement the following best practices:
This includes identifying API endpoints, authentication mechanisms, and data formats.
API Security: The Hidden Threat Lurking in the Background
APIs have become an integral part of modern software development, providing a layer of abstraction between applications and services. However, this increased reliance on APIs has also led to a rise in API security incidents. Poorly designed APIs are a significant contributor to these incidents, and it’s essential to address this issue to prevent further breaches.
The Risks of Poorly Designed APIs
These risks can have severe consequences, including data breaches, denial-of-service attacks, and even financial losses.
In 2022, the number of API attacks increased by 50% compared to the previous year. The number of API attacks is expected to continue to rise in the future.
The Rise of API Attacks
API attacks have become a significant concern for organizations in recent years.
However, “the root cause of the problem is not addressed,” according to the company. “The root cause is the poorly designed API.”
The Problem of Poorly Designed APIs
Poorly designed APIs can lead to a range of issues, from security vulnerabilities to usability problems. When APIs are not designed with security and usability in mind, they can become a target for attackers and users alike. This can result in a range of negative consequences, including data breaches, financial losses, and damage to a company’s reputation. Some common issues with poorly designed APIs include: + Lack of authentication and authorization + Inadequate error handling + Insufficient input validation + Insecure data storage and transmission
The Impact of Poorly Designed APIs
The impact of poorly designed APIs can be far-reaching and devastating. Some of the consequences include:
API abuse and exploitation are major concerns for organizations due to lack of visibility into API endpoints.
This staggering number highlights the potential for API abuse and exploitation.
Understanding the Risks of Lack of Visibility APIs
Lack of visibility into API endpoints is a significant concern for organizations. Without proper monitoring, it’s challenging to detect and respond to API-related threats. This lack of visibility can lead to:
The Impact of Lack of Visibility APIs on Organizations
The consequences of lack of visibility APIs can be severe. Organizations that fail to monitor their API endpoints may experience:
The Role of API Security in Threat Detection
API security plays a crucial role in threat detection.
API Security: The Importance of Visibility
APIs are the backbone of modern software development, providing a layer of abstraction between applications and the underlying infrastructure. However, with the increasing complexity of modern applications, APIs have become a prime target for cyber threats.
This lack of attention to API security can lead to serious consequences, including data breaches, financial losses, and reputational damage.
The Risks of API Security Neglect
APIs are a critical component of modern software development, providing a secure and efficient way to exchange data between applications. However, the increasing reliance on APIs has also led to a growing number of vulnerabilities and security risks. Without adequate security measures, APIs can be exploited by malicious actors, resulting in devastating consequences. Data breaches: APIs can be used to access sensitive data, including financial information, personal identifiable information, and confidential business data. If an API is compromised, an attacker can gain unauthorized access to this data, leading to serious consequences for the organization. Financial losses: APIs can also be used to manipulate financial transactions, leading to significant financial losses for the organization. This can include unauthorized transactions, money laundering, and other financial crimes. * Reputational damage: A data breach or other security incident involving an API can have severe reputational consequences for the organization. This can lead to a loss of customer trust, damage to the organization’s brand, and decreased business revenue.**
The Consequences of Inadequate API Security
The consequences of inadequate API security can be severe and far-reaching.
API security is a critical component of any organization’s overall security posture. It’s not just about securing the API itself, but also about securing the data it handles and the systems it interacts with.
Understanding the API Security Landscape
API security is a rapidly evolving field, with new threats and vulnerabilities emerging all the time. The increasing use of APIs has created a new attack surface for hackers to exploit. As a result, organizations must stay vigilant and proactive in their API security efforts. Key challenges in API security include:
- Authentication and authorization
- Data encryption
- Input validation and sanitization
- Rate limiting and IP blocking
- API key management
The Benefits of an API-First Approach
Organizations that adopt an API-first strategy are better equipped to handle the unique security challenges posed by APIs. By prioritizing API security from the outset, organizations can:
Implementing API Security Measures
Implementing effective API security measures requires a proactive and multi-faceted approach.
“We’re not seeing a lot of adoption of these best practices, and that’s what’s concerning.”
The Importance of Strong Authentication and Authorization
A Critical Component of API Security
Strong authentication and authorization are essential components of API security. Without them, APIs can be vulnerable to unauthorized access, data breaches, and other security threats. In this article, we will explore the importance of strong authentication and authorization across all API endpoints.